Restroom Floor Replacement Questions
What is involved in restroom floor replacement? The process typically includes removing the existing flooring, preparing the subfloor, and installing new materials such as tile, vinyl, or laminate to ensure durability and a finished look.
What types of flooring are suitable for restroom replacement? Common options include ceramic or porcelain tile, vinyl, and waterproof laminate, all chosen for their resistance to moisture and ease of maintenance.
How can I prepare for restroom floor replacement? Property owners should clear the area of personal items, ensure access to plumbing fixtures, and discuss any specific preferences or concerns with the contractor beforehand.
Is additional work needed beyond replacing the floor? Sometimes, underlying issues like damaged subflooring or plumbing leaks are identified during removal and may require repairs before new flooring can be installed.
